Rear view of Basking shark (Cetorhinus maximus) feeding on plankton in the surface waters around the island of Coll, Inner Hebrides, Scotland, UK, June. Did you know? The basking shark is the worlds second largest fish, reaching 12 metres in length. It is commonly seen off
British coasts between May and October
